NVIDIA RTX 30-series cards have a maximum temp of 93C, meaning they can run this hot without throttling speeds or shutting down. To check your NVIDIA card’s maximum temperature, you can look at its specifications as listed by NVIDIA. Not only will this ensure that performance isn’t throttled and your games don’t crash, but it will also reduce long-term damage to your card and increase its longevity. Normal temperatures should be as far below this limit as possible. GPU manufacturers put safety measures in place to throttle its performance or shut it down when its temperature hits a certain maximum threshold – this is the temperature limit. GPU Temperature Limit – Normal GPU Temperatures And if all else fails, you can install an aftermarket GPU cooler or RMA your graphics card if it seems so hot as to be defective. If this doesn’t work, check everything is running properly inside the PC, especially the graphics card’s fans. If it’s running too hot, remove any overclocks and make its fan curve more aggressive. To check your GPU temps, load a graphically intensive benchmark like Unigine Valley while monitoring your GPU’s temperature with software like MSI Afterburner. Modern AMD GPUs should stay below 100C under full load to be safe, although the most recent AMD GPUs hit their max temperature at 110C. Modern NVIDIA GPUs should stay below 85C under full load to be safe, although many can exceed this by a few degrees before hitting their max temperatures.
